Very Proactive and Very Hepful

On 01/25/2013, Officer First responded to the call I placed in regards to a wallet which I believed I had lost while pumping gas at the Circle K listed above. I got to my next stop, ULTA, on Market St. in Gilbert and realized when I went to pay that I did not have my wallet. I went back to my car, searched it and outside the car and could not find it. I returned to the Circle K knowing I had used my debit card to purchase gas and asked at the counter if a wallet had been turned in, but it had not. I then called the Gilbert Police and Officer First responded. He reviewed the surveillance tape. It appeared that several people had since used that pump, but if it had been there, did not notice it. Then, someone pulled up to that pump, got out, bent over and then got back in the car and drove off. He could not tell what he picked up nor the license plate, because of the sun glare on the back of the car. I received a call this morning from Onstar saying they had an employee from Bed, Bath and Beyond on the phone saying that a customer had turned in the wallet they found in the parking lot on the day of the incident. I have picked up the wallet and it was completely intact. I have called the department and spoke to an officer to let the department know it was retrieved. The reason for this e-mail is to tell you that Officer Pillar was so kind to me when taking the report. I have been seriously ill and had just received an IV infusion treatment and was very shaken over this incident. He could not have been more helpful or patient and kind. I want you to know he was very proactive and very, very helpful to me and to my husband who left work and came while Officer First was investigating. I think he is a wonderful example and representative of the Gilbert Police Dept., and wanted to let him and his supervisor to know how much I appreciated his thoroughness, and most especially his kindness. I hope that this note of appreciation will be put in his file and also expressed to him and his supervisors. I wish him the best in his career, and will never forget his kindness. You are lucky to have someone like him representing the department. My thanks and gratitude go out to him. Thank you! N. Hammer
